Ambulance Support Team, Team Leader

4 months ago


Alfreton, United Kingdom East Midlands Ambulance Service NHS Trust Full time

An exciting opportunity to join our Ambulance Support Team Member (nights) based in Alfreton, Derbyshire as a Team Leader. The post holder will lead a team carrying out ambulance cleaning and preparation duties to set infection control standards and ensure that vehicles are ready to respond to emergencies.

The post holder will also be required to drive ambulances and other Trust vehicles between bases as part of their normal duties.

This position requires the ability to communicate effectively both in writing and verbally with good hand eye coordination, work under pressure and meet deadlines.

In addition to Vehicle Deep Cleaning duties, responsible for the day to day supervision of the
Ambulance Support Team members and delivery of objectives of the team. Responsible for
the performance management, assessments, audits and development of the Ambulance
Support Team to the required standards set out by IPC. To maintain and develop best
practices in health and safety at work.

**Main responsibilities**:
1. Working with the day shift Team Leader supervising the attendance, performance and conduct of the team members in accordance with Trust policies. To carry out informal/formal discussions where necessary, referring to the Head of Operational Support as appropriate.
2. Carries out Vehicle Deep Cleaning preparation duties alongside the team members on a rotating shift basis relative to locality and operational demand.
3. Responsible for carrying out assessments/audits in line with IPC compliance, and annual appraisals for staff within the Ambulance Support Team.
4. Monitors the deliveries of services, ensuring appropriate standards are maintained at all times, to a set infection control standard. Ensures that Trust vehicles and equipment are maintained in a safe and appropriate condition, reporting any defects or damage in accordance with the prescribed procedure/ carry out minor vehicle maintenance.
5. Liaise directly with the Supplies Department regarding stock ordering and stock control. Also with fleet, control, crews and the Resource Manager regarding vehicle availability and Equipment Repairers regarding equipment repairs as and when required.
6. Monitors compliance with the Trust’s policies on the equipping and fuelling of vehicles, use of supplies etc. Compiles records on these as necessary and reports problems to the Line Manager.

7. Assists in the development and maintenance of good health and safety practice at work, advising staff on policy and reporting any deficiencies to the appropriate manager. Including risk assessments when appropriate
8. Provide support to major incident procedures as required for example equipment or supplies taken to the scene.
9. Assists in the monitoring and supervision of staff attendance in accordance with the Trust’s Procedure for Managing Sickness Absence.
10.To ensure that work is organised for the team members, including prioritising workload in line with organisational/divisional targets and priorities.
11.Manage workload, ensure a timely and quality service, deliver high standards of administration ensuring that work is planned and prioritised in accordance with organisational targets and key performance indicators.
12.Manage requests for annual leave and maintain annual leave records.
13.Assists in the investigation and collation of information regarding complaints concerning the Ambulance Support Team.
14.Assists in the selection of new staff and is responsible for their training, induction and development advising them on policies and practices within the service as necessary.
15.Maintains appropriate record systems to support the effective management of staff and resources. Ensures the security of patient and staff confidential information in line with data protection legislation.
